A forge dating from 1521, which was one of the largest wood-fired forges in France, producing cast iron in a blast furnace and refinery.

This 1521 forge owes much to the Combescot family, whose history is closely linked to that of the area. It was one of the large wood-burning forges that produced cast iron in a blast furnace and a refinery. It relied on water power and peasant labor in winter. It survived until 1930, when the blast furnace was shut down. A rich and moving tour reveals the workings and lives of the families on site.
